iOS应用的签名方式简介,保障您的设备安全!
iOS应用的签名是苹果公司设计的一种安全机制,是通过证书的方式来保障用户设备的安全企业注册苹果开发者账号。本文将在下面介绍iOS应用的签名方式,帮助用户更好的了解这一机制。
苹果签名机制的定义与原理
苹果签名是苹果公司开发的一种安全机制,通过证书方式来保障用户设备的安全。在iOS开发者提交应用程序到App Store后,苹果公司会通过签名机制对这些应用进行数字签名,当用户从App Store下载这些应用时,苹果设备可以验证这些应用数字签名的真实性,以保证用户设备的安全性。
iOS签名证书的种类
iOS签名证书主要分四类:开发者证书、发布证书、企业证书、开发者中心证书。其中,开发者证书和发布证书用于发布应用到App Store,企业证书用于企业内部分发应用,开发者中心证书用于iOS开发者在开发过程中测试应用。ios企业证书检测
苹果签名机制的使用流程
苹果签名机制的使用流程十分简单。当用户从App Store下载应用时,用户设备首先会解压应用文件,然后验证应用的签名。设备会首先获取应用的签名证书,证书中包含了签名机构信息、应用信息以及签名时间等内容。然后,设备会连接苹果服务器,从苹果服务器获取本地时间和苹果证书吊销列表苹果怎么安装证书。接着,设备会核对应用签名时间是否在证书有效期之内,验证证书是否在吊销列表中是否存在。如果应用签名信息有效,设备就可以验证应用是否可信,如果应用签名信息无效,设备就会提示用户应用已损坏或有可能存在安全隐患。
iOS应用签名的优势
iOS应用签名机制具有以下优势:苹果 代理
应用的真实性得到验证,在用户的设备上安装应用时可以信任应用。
可以检查应用的完整性,以防止应用被篡改而出现异常。
可以检查应用的有效期限,从而保证应用不会被滥用。
结语
iOS应用的签名是一种非常有效的安全机制,可以有效地保护用户设备的安全。对于开发者来说,合理使用iOS签名证书可以使得应用在App Store上得到更好的评分,得到更多的用户信任。因此,开发者应该重视iOS签名证书的使用。苹果企业微信怎么用